I meant that 123 Fake St. was used on an episode of The Simpsons. I certainly didn't make things clear, sorry. Marge uses it as a fake address when on the phone to Chief Wiggum in "Trilogy of Error," the quasi-parody of the movie
Go. It's the episode where Homer has his thumb severed and features the delightful grammar robot made by Lisa, Linguo. It's funny because Marge cannot think of anything on-the-spot, and then gives "123 Fake St." Later, the police raid the location, which, humorously, is a Springfield address.
